Showings by appointment only. Please call/text/email for an appointment. This spacious and sun-drenched residence spans 1,140 sf with 112 ceiling height and abundant natural light. Situated on the top floor of an art deco building, this home abounds with sunshine and blue skies from southern and eastern exposures. The bedrooms boast ample closet space, while a large living room and expansive dining room with French doors offer versatile living, doubling as a spacious third bedroom.

The neighborhood where "Saturday Night Fever" was set has resisted the waves of change sweeping through other parts of Brooklyn. Bay Ridge remains a haven for long-term residents and local businesses. The Verrazano-Narrows Bridge dominates the skyline, and single-family row houses make up the majority of the housing stock. Renters priced out of Park Slope may find a similar community vibe here, at a decidedly lower price.
